Generalized Bill Notices Report
• | Pipe-delimited Output |
The Generalized Bill Notices (Bill) report produces bill notices, which can be sorted by group ID, user name, user ID, or zip code. The report lists both paid and unpaid bills, unless No is selected for the Bills Paid in Full option. By default, the Bills Paid in Full option is set to No. Each bill is itemized, but you must select the Total Bills for Each User check box on the Bill Notice tab to include a bill total.
When the library address is included in a notice, the address is drawn from the user record with a user ID which matches the User ID attribute of the appropriate Library policy.
This report contains the following tabs.
• | Basic Tab: Reports |
• | Bill Notice Tab |
• | Bill Selection Tab |
• | Produce Mailing Labels Tab |
• | Sorting Tab |
• | User Accountability Selection Tab |
• | User Selection Tab |
• | User Status Selection Tab |
• | Print Separate Reports for Each Library Tab |
The text of the notices that are available for printing can be defined by your library.
If Generate Pipe Delimited Output is selected on the Charge Notice tab, the report creates a pipe-delimited file and places it in the /Rptprint directory with the naming convention of yyyymmdd_internalrptname.pipe. The report log lists the pipe-delimited report file name. This pipe-delimited file can be opened using a third-party application, such as a spreadsheet application.
Sorting selections made within the report are not applied to pipe-delimited files. For example, if you sort the report by zip code, the zip code sort is not applied to the contents of the pipe-delimited file.
The entries listed in the Brief Entries attribute of the User Address Format wizards are used to supply information for the address fields in the pipe-delimited file. The City/State field (if it is used) is evaluated as one field, not as two separate fields for the city and the state. The report will check user records for the fields listed in the Brief Entries attribute and print only the populated fields in the pipe-delimited output.
Pipe-delimited Key File
The pipe-delimited key file defines each field of the pipe-delimited file for a particular notice.
The following pipe-delimited key file defines the fields for a bill notice.
|date|Library|street|line|city, state|zip|username|street|line|city,
state|zip|salutation|notice text|title|author|date billed|bill reason|
amount due|total feefines|closing text|
The following example shows a pipe-delimited key file for a bill notice, and the notice output that is produced from the file.
|Friday, May 12, 2006|Rockerfeller Public Library|123 Main St.|
|St. Louis, MO|35801|Tom Patron|1234 Fair Oaks Lane||St Louis, MO|55555|
Dear Tom Patron,|”FIRST BILL” We are taking the liberty of calling your
attention to the fact that you owe the Library some money for the
following bill. Please pay this bill at your earliest convenience.
Thank you.
|Adventures of Huckleberry Finn : Tom Sawyer’s comrade / Mark Twain ;
edited by Walter Blair and Victor Fischer.|Twain, Mark,
1835-1910.|5/12/2006|PROCESSFEE|$5.00|Adventures of Huckleberry Finn :
Tom Sawyer’s comrade / Mark Twain ; edited by Walter Blair andVictor
Fischer.|Twain, Mark, 1835-1910.|5/12/2006|OVERDUE|$.70|$5.70||
Friday, May 12, 2006
Rockerfeller Public Library
123 Main St.
St. Louis, MO
35801
Tom Patron
1234 Fair Oaks Lane
St Louis, MO
55555
Dear Tom Patron,
”FIRST BILL”
We are taking the liberty of calling your attention to the fact
that you owe the Library some money for the following bill.
Please pay this bill at your earliest convenience.
Thank you.
1 Adventures of Huckleberry Finn : Tom Sawyer’s comrade / Mark Twain ;
edited by Walter Blair and Victor Fischer.
Twain, Mark, 1835-1910.
date billed:5/12/2006 bill reason:PROCESSFEE amount due: $5.00
2 Adventures of Huckleberry Finn : Tom Sawyer’s comrade / Mark Twain ;
edited by Walter Blair and Victor Fischer.
Twain, Mark, 1835-1910.
date billed:5/12/2006 bill reason:OVERDUE amount due: $.70
=======================================================================
TOTAL FINES/FEES AND UNPAID BILLS: $5.70
Related topics